scatterlist: Don't allocate sg lists using __get_free_page
Allocating pages with __get_free_page is slower than going through the slab allocator to grab free pages out from a pool. These are the results from running the code at the bottom of this message: [ 1.278602] speedtest: __get_free_page: 9 us [ 1.278606] speedtest: kmalloc: 4 us [ 1.278609] speedtest: kmem_cache_alloc: 4 us [ 1.278611] speedtest: vmalloc: 13 us kmalloc and kmem_cache_alloc (which is what kmalloc uses for common sizes behind the scenes) are the fastest choices. Use kmalloc to speed up sg list allocation. FROMLIST: lib/string.c: Optimize memchr()
The original version of memchr() is implemented with the byte-wise comparing technique, which does not fully use 64-bits or 32-bits registers in CPU. We use word-wide comparing so that 8 characters can be compared at the same time on CPU. This code is base on David Laight's implementation. We create two files to measure the performance. The first file contains on average 10 characters ahead the target character. The second file contains at least 1000 characters ahead the target character. Our implementation of “memchr()” is slightly better in the first test and nearly 4x faster than the orginal implementation in the second test. BACKPORT: string: improve default out-of-line memcmp() implementation
This just does the "if the architecture does efficient unaligned handling, start the memcmp using 'unsigned long' accesses", since Nikolay Borisov found a load that cares. This is basically the minimal patch, and limited to architectures that are known to not have slow unaligned handling. We've had the stupid byte-at-a-time version forever, and nobody has ever even noticed before, so let's keep the fix minimal. A potential further improvement would be to align one of the sources in order to at least minimize unaligned cases, but the only real case of bigger memcmp() users seems to be the FIDEDUPERANGE ioctl(). As David Sterba says, the dedupe ioctl is typically called on ranges spanning many pages so the common case will all be page-aligned anyway. All the relevant architectures select HAVE_EFFICIENT_UNALIGNED_ACCESS, so I'm not going to worry about the combination of a very rare use-case and a rare architecture until somebody actually hits it. Particularly since Nikolay also tested the more complex patch with extra alignment handling code, and it only added overhead. BACKPORT: lib/crc32.c: mark crc32_le_base/__crc32c_le_base aliases as __pure
The upcoming GCC 9 release extends the -Wmissing-attributes warnings (enabled by -Wall) to C and aliases: it warns when particular function attributes are missing in the aliases but not in their target. In particular, it triggers here because crc32_le_base/__crc32c_le_base aren't __pure while their target crc32_le/__crc32c_le are. These aliases are used by architectures as a fallback in accelerated versions of CRC32. See commit 9784d82db3eb ("lib/crc32: make core crc32() routines weak so they can be overridden"). Therefore, being fallbacks, it is likely that even if the aliases were called from C, there wouldn't be any optimizations possible. Currently, the only user is arm64, which calls this from asm. Still, marking the aliases as __pure makes sense and is a good idea for documentation purposes and possible future optimizations, which also silences the warning. lib/lzo: fix ambiguous encoding bug in lzo-rle
In some rare cases, for input data over 32 KB, lzo-rle could encode two different inputs to the same compressed representation, so that decompression is then ambiguous (i.e. data may be corrupted - although zram is not affected because it operates over 4 KB pages). This modifies the compressor without changing the decompressor or the bitstream format, such that: - there is no change to how data produced by the old compressor is decompressed - an old decompressor will correctly decode data from the updated compressor - performance and compression ratio are not affected - we avoid introducing a new bitstream format In testing over 12.8M real-world files totalling 903 GB, three files were affected by this bug. I also constructed 37M semi-random 64 KB files totalling 2.27 TB, and saw no affected files. Finally I tested over files constructed to contain each of the ~1024 possible bad input sequences; for all of these cases, updated lzo-rle worked correctly. There is no significant impact to performance or compression ratio. lib/lzo: implement run-length encoding
Patch series "lib/lzo: run-length encoding support", v5. Following on from the previous lzo-rle patchset: https://lkml.org/lkml/2018/11/30/972 This patchset contains only the RLE patches, and should be applied on top of the non-RLE patches ( https://lkml.org/lkml/2019/2/5/366 ). Previously, some questions were raised around the RLE patches. I've done some additional benchmarking to answer these questions. In short: - RLE offers significant additional performance (data-dependent) - I didn't measure any regressions that were clearly outside the noise One concern with this patchset was around performance - specifically, measuring RLE impact separately from Matt Sealey's patches (CTZ & fast copy). I have done some additional benchmarking which I hope clarifies the benefits of each part of the patchset. Firstly, I've captured some memory via /dev/fmem from a Chromebook with many tabs open which is starting to swap, and then split this into 4178 4k pages. I've excluded the all-zero pages (as zram does), and also the no-zero pages (which won't tell us anything about RLE performance). This should give a realistic test dataset for zram. What I found was that the data is VERY bimodal: 44% of pages in this dataset contain 5% or fewer zeros, and 44% contain over 90% zeros (30% if you include the no-zero pages). This supports the idea of special-casing zeros in zram. Next, I've benchmarked four variants of lzo on these pages (on 64-bit Arm at max frequency): baseline LZO; baseline + Matt Sealey's patches (aka MS); baseline + RLE only; baseline + MS + RLE. Numbers are for weighted roundtrip throughput (the weighting reflects that zram does more compression than decompression). https://drive.google.com/file/d/1VLtLjRVxgUNuWFOxaGPwJYhl_hMQXpHe/view?usp=sharing Matt's patches help in all cases for Arm (and no effect on Intel), as expected. RLE also behaves as expected: with few zeros present, it makes no difference; above ~75%, it gives a good improvement (50 - 300 MB/s on top of the benefit from Matt's patches). Best performance is seen with both MS and RLE patches. Finally, I have benchmarked the same dataset on an x86-64 device. Here, the MS patches make no difference (as expected); RLE helps, similarly as on Arm. There were no definite regressions; allowing for observational error, 0.1% (3/4178) of cases had a regression > 1 standard deviation, of which the largest was 4.6% (1.2 standard deviations). I think this is probably within the noise. https://drive.google.com/file/d/1xCUVwmiGD0heEMx5gcVEmLBI4eLaageV/view?usp=sharing One point to note is that the graphs show RLE appears to help very slightly with no zeros present! This is because the extra code causes the clang optimiser to change code layout in a way that happens to have a significant benefit. Taking baseline LZO and adding a do-nothing line like "__builtin_prefetch(out_len);" immediately before the "goto next" has the same effect. So this is a real, but basically spurious effect - it's small enough not to upset the overall findings. This patch (of 3): When using zram, we frequently encounter long runs of zero bytes. This adds a special case which identifies runs of zeros and encodes them using run-length encoding. This is faster for both compression and decompresion. For high-entropy data which doesn't hit this case, impact is minimal. Compression ratio is within a few percent in all cases. This modifies the bitstream in a way which is backwards compatible (i.e., we can decompress old bitstreams, but old versions of lzo cannot decompress new bitstreams). lz4: fix kernel decompression speed
This patch replaces all memcpy() calls with LZ4_memcpy() which calls __builtin_memcpy() so the compiler can inline it. LZ4 relies heavily on memcpy() with a constant size being inlined. In x86 and i386 pre-boot environments memcpy() cannot be inlined because memcpy() doesn't get defined as __builtin_memcpy(). An equivalent patch has been applied upstream so that the next import won't lose this change [1]. I've measured the kernel decompression speed using QEMU before and after this patch for the x86_64 and i386 architectures. The speed-up is about 10x as shown below. Code Arch Kernel Size Time Speed v5.8 x86_64 11504832 B 148 ms 79 MB/s patch x86_64 11503872 B 13 ms 885 MB/s v5.8 i386 9621216 B 91 ms 106 MB/s patch i386 9620224 B 10 ms 962 MB/s I also measured the time to decompress the initramfs on x86_64, i386, and arm. All three show the same decompression speed before and after, as expected. once: add DO_ONCE_SLOW() for sleepable contexts
[ Upstream commit 62c07983bef9d3e78e71189441e1a470f0d1e653 ] Christophe Leroy reported a ~80ms latency spike happening at first TCP connect() time. This is because __inet_hash_connect() uses get_random_once() to populate a perturbation table which became quite big after commit 4c2c8f03a5ab ("tcp: increase source port perturb table to 2^16") get_random_once() uses DO_ONCE(), which block hard irqs for the duration of the operation. This patch adds DO_ONCE_SLOW() which uses a mutex instead of a spinlock for operations where we prefer to stay in process context. Then __inet_hash_connect() can use get_random_slow_once() to populate its perturbation table. lib/list_debug.c: Detect uninitialized lists
[ Upstream commit 0cc011c576aaa4de505046f7a6c90933d7c749a9 ] In some circumstances, attempts are made to add entries to or to remove entries from an uninitialized list. A prime example is amdgpu_bo_vm_destroy(): It is indirectly called from ttm_bo_init_reserved() if that function fails, and tries to remove an entry from a list. However, that list is only initialized in amdgpu_bo_create_vm() after the call to ttm_bo_init_reserved() returned success. This results in crashes such as BUG: kernel NULL pointer dereference, address: 0000000000000000 #PF: supervisor read access in kernel mode #PF: error_code(0x0000) - not-present page PGD 0 P4D 0 Oops: 0000 [#1] PREEMPT SMP NOPTI CPU: 1 PID: 1479 Comm: chrome Not tainted 5.10.110-15768-g29a72e65dae5 Hardware name: Google Grunt/Grunt, BIOS Google_Grunt.11031.149.0 07/15/2020 RIP: 0010:__list_del_entry_valid+0x26/0x7d ... Call Trace: amdgpu_bo_vm_destroy+0x48/0x8b ttm_bo_init_reserved+0x1d7/0x1e0 amdgpu_bo_create+0x212/0x476 ? amdgpu_bo_user_destroy+0x23/0x23 ? kmem_cache_alloc+0x60/0x271 amdgpu_bo_create_vm+0x40/0x7d amdgpu_vm_pt_create+0xe8/0x24b ... Check if the list's prev and next pointers are NULL to catch such problems. ida: don't use BUG_ON() for debugging
commit fc82bbf4dede758007763867d0282353c06d1121 upstream.
This is another old BUG_ON() that just shouldn't exist (see also commit
a382f8fee42c: "signal handling: don't use BUG_ON() for debugging").
In fact, as Matthew Wilcox points out, this condition shouldn't really
even result in a warning, since a negative id allocation result is just
a normal allocation failure:
"I wonder if we should even warn here -- sure, the caller is trying to
free something that wasn't allocated, but we don't warn for
kfree(NULL)"
and goes on to point out how that current error check is only causing
people to unnecessarily do their own index range checking before freeing
it.
This was noted by Itay Iellin, because the bluetooth HCI socket cookie
code does *not* do that range checking, and ends up just freeing the
error case too, triggering the BUG_ON().
The HCI code requires CAP_NET_RAW, and seems to just result in an ugly
splat, but there really is no reason to BUG_ON() here, and we have
generally striven for allocation models where it's always ok to just do
free(alloc());
even if the allocation were to fail for some random reason (usually
obviously that "random" reason being some resource limit).
